Salman Khan Roasts Himself While Confronting His Impersonator on The Great Indian Kapil Show

In a hilarious and self-aware moment, Bollywood superstar Salman Khan made a memorable appearance on the third season of The Great Indian Kapil Show, where he confronted an impersonator of himself and ended up roasting his own film, Sikandar. The episode, which will stream on Netflix starting June 21, 2025, has already generated immense buzz thanks to the witty exchanges and comic timing showcased in the promotional clips.

The promo opens with Kapil Sharma introducing the panel of impersonators who mimic various Bollywood celebrities. Among them is a Salman Khan lookalike imitating his popular Radhe Bhaiyya persona, famously associated with action-packed roles and Salman’s unique swag. True to form, Salman Khan engages with the impersonator in his signature style, asking him, “Kaam dhanda accha chalra hai? Sikandar se koi farak to nahi pada?” This roughly translates to, “Is your work going well? Has Sikandar affected you in any way?”

The impersonator, maintaining a cheerful demeanor, assures him that things are going fine. The entire audience erupts in laughter, but the most surprising moment comes next—Salman Khan smiles and takes a playful dig at himself and his latest movie. This unexpected self-roast left the audience clapping and hooting, proving once again why Salman Khan continues to hold a special place in the hearts of millions.

Sikandar, which was released on March 30, 2025, on the occasion of Eid, was a highly anticipated film directed by A.R. Murugadoss and starred Rashmika Mandanna opposite Salman Khan. Despite a decent box office run—reportedly crossing ₹121 crore—the film received mixed reviews. While it performed well commercially, it failed to match the high expectations typically associated with Salman’s Eid releases. The star’s comment during the show reflects his grounded personality and his ability to laugh at himself, even when things don't go perfectly.

The third season of The Great Indian Kapil Show has brought back its all-star ensemble including Kapil Sharma, Navjot Singh Sidhu, Archana Puran Singh, Sunil Grover, and Krushna Abhishek. The show, known for its celebrity interviews blended with stand-up comedy and skits, continues to draw in a wide audience across age groups.
